As winter approaches, several states in the United States are bracing for snowstorms and hazardous road conditions. The National Weather Service (NWS) has issued multiple Winter Weather Advisories for regions in Nebraska, Iowa, Kansas, Illinois, Ohio, and California, warning residents of expected snow accumulations and slippery roads.
In southeast Nebraska, a Winter Weather Advisory is in effect from 3 AM to 6 PM CST on Monday, with total snow accumulations between 2 and 4 inches. Similar advisories have been issued for portions of north central, northwest, and west central Illinois, as well as east central Iowa, where snow is expected to accumulate between 2 and 4 inches from noon on Monday to midnight CST.
In Kansas, central, east central, north central, and northeast regions are expected to receive between 1 and 3 inches of snow, with isolated amounts around 4 inches. The advisory is in effect from midnight tonight to 6 PM CST on Monday. Additionally, southern Erie county in Ohio is under a Lake Effect Snow Advisory, with total snow accumulations of 2 to 4 inches and gusty winds.
In California, a Freeze Watch has been issued for Indian Wells Valley, Mojave Desert, and Mojave Desert Slopes, with sub-freezing temperatures as low as 29 degrees possible from Monday evening through Tuesday morning. The advisory warns of frost and freeze conditions that could harm crops and sensitive vegetation.
